CHICAGO — A 16-year-old boy was injured in an Englewood shooting Sunday night, according to police.

The boy was outside in the 6700 block of South Sangamon Street at 9:20 p.m. when two men walked out of a nearby gangway and fired shots, said Officer Jose Estrada, Chicago Police spokesman.

He was struck in his left hand and was taken to Stroger Hospital in good condition, Estrada said.

No arrests have been made as the investigation is ongoing, Estrada said.
